Hi. Though I'm not an attorney, I do deal with copyright issues on a regular basis, and you unfortunately made a very common mistake that a lot (actually most people) make. Many assume that because something is in the public domain it is available for free use -- that is not the case. You need to check a company's (in this case amazon's, B&N's, and Mattel's) fair use terms. Most fair use terms specify that you can use images for personal, not-for-profit activities only. Your UA-cam channel is public and, unless I'm wrong, it's monetized (you receive some sort of compensation). I'm in no way saying that you should have known this nor am I repremanding you. Most people don't know this. I wouldn't know this if I didn't work in my field. So even if Mattel leaked the images on both amazon and B&N, unless all three websites indicated that the images were available without any restrictions, you can't use them in a public forum (it's not just personal use) -- especially if you are making a profit. Again, I'm not trying to be mean, but this is important and I don't want you to run into this issue again. Just check those terms of use or fair use terms (usually hidden way down at the bottom of most websites). If the terms of use are inconsistent, assume the most conservative ones are in effect.
